首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

链接列表中的插入排序

插入排序是一种简单直观的排序算法,它的基本思想是将一个记录插入到已经排好序的有序序列中,从而得到一个新的、记录数增加1的有序序列。

插入排序可以分为直接插入排序和二分插入排序两种方式。

  1. 直接插入排序:
    • 概念:直接插入排序是将待排序的元素按照大小顺序依次插入到已经排好序的序列中的适当位置,直到所有元素都插入完毕。
    • 优势:简单易实现,适用于小规模数据的排序。
    • 应用场景:适用于数据量较小且基本有序的情况。
    • 推荐的腾讯云相关产品:腾讯云云服务器(CVM)。
    • 产品介绍链接地址:https://cloud.tencent.com/product/cvm
  • 二分插入排序:
    • 概念:二分插入排序是在直接插入排序的基础上,通过二分查找的方式寻找插入位置,减少比较次数,提高排序效率。
    • 优势:相较于直接插入排序,比较次数更少,适用于数据量较大的排序。
    • 应用场景:适用于数据量较大且基本有序的情况。
    • 推荐的腾讯云相关产品:腾讯云云数据库 MySQL 版。
    • 产品介绍链接地址:https://cloud.tencent.com/product/cdb_mysql

总结:插入排序是一种简单但有效的排序算法,适用于小规模或基本有序的数据排序。腾讯云提供了云服务器和云数据库 MySQL 版等产品,可以满足不同规模和需求的云计算场景。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

16分18秒

39、尚硅谷_SpringBoot_web开发-【实验】-员工列表-链接高亮&列表完成.avi

9分6秒

40主页面中的会话列表页面.avi

17分18秒

66、尚硅谷_总结_超级链接的完善.wmv

31分16秒

10.使用 Utils 在列表中请求图片.avi

20分43秒

40-尚硅谷-Scala数据结构和算法-插入排序的实现

3分48秒

39-尚硅谷-Scala数据结构和算法-插入排序的思路分析

11分16秒

100_尚硅谷_爬虫_scrapy_链接提取器的使用

8分50秒

文件上传与下载专题-11-超链接方式的文件下载

31分52秒

042-尚硅谷-尚品汇-search模块中动态展示产品列表

7分43秒

HTML基础教程-15-超链接的作用-request和response的概念【动力节点】

13分40秒

第二十章:类的加载过程详解/66-链接之验证环节

11分13秒

第二十章:类的加载过程详解/67-链接之准备环节

领券